Abstract
Chinese people accommodated Buddhism through the Taoistic background, it is called Kyeak ui(格義, Buddhism paraphrase by Taoism) Buddhism. Taoism has been became the background and mental soil for the doctrine of Buddhism acceptable in China. On the contrary, Taoism as a religion effected by Buddhism that brought in China. Buddhism interpreted as a philosophy of Taoist hermit, and Buddhism in China has been played role as a kind of Taoist hermit. Buddhist's Breathing interpreted as idea of Naedan(內丹,internal alchemy), particularly Zen Buddhism share the Taoism discipline. Chinese Buddhism absorbed supernatural folk belief, and took root in East Asia including China. Chinese are interested in Buddhism for good luck and ward off calamities by Buddha's blessing. Buddhism has accepted as a belief form of temporal and utilitarian Taoism at Late Han Dynasty. Buddhism based on Taoistic thought naturally became a religion in the East Asia. Inner Elixir practice abdominal breathing like Zen practice. ‘Danjean(lower abdomen) is the moving vitality to be between belly and kidney. Danjean is the basic power of human beings where indwell mental and the source of five vitalities. Zen Buddhism in China highlighted practice of Zen, whose Sitting and Breathing similar to the Inner Elixir in Taoism. The slower breathing with the abdomen make keeping the calmly mind. Kōan Zen related to traditional Taoistic idea that originated from pure talking at Six Dynasty China. Pure Talking in their tradition that can not be understood as common sense were deployed as a Zen riddle.
